Patricia Mae Bliss Obituary

It is always difficult saying goodbye to someone we love and cherish. Family and friends must say goodbye to their beloved Patricia Mae Bliss of Omaha, Arkansas, who passed away, on June 14, 2020. You can send your sympathy in the guestbook provided and share it with the family.

She was predeceased by: her parents, Jess Stalnaker and Grace Stalnaker (Myford); and her brothers, Charles, James and Gerald Stalnaker.

She is survived by: her son Duane Bliss (Carla) of Omaha, Arkansas; her significant other Alfred "Al" Bliss of Omaha, Arkansas; her grandchildren, Alyson Bliss and Michelle Brown-Gamble (Brett); her siblings, Sharon Ayers of Akron, Anna Kelly of Richfield, Norma Riedle of Sycamore, Ohio, Bob Stalnaker (Eva) of Fort Myers and Jake Stalnaker (Pat) of Arlington, Texas; and her sisters-in-law, Alice Farris (Mike) of Fort Myers Beach and Lila Hein (Don) of Lehigh Acres, Florida. She is also survived by numerous nieces, nephews, and extended family.
